Contributor Biography
Michael Hanke is a psychologist by training and a programmer by night. After having received his PhD from Magdeburg University in 2009, he spent two years as a postdoc in the lab of Jim Haxby at Dartmouth college. During this time, he first started working on combining open source techniques with open data to do open science. After his return to Magdeburg, he is current heading the psychoinformatics research group at the Center for Behavioral Brain Sciences.
